About the certification

Mastering IT Service Management Frameworks

The qualification validates a deep, practical understanding of the Information Technology Infrastructure Library framework. Freelancers holding this status have advanced beyond foundational concepts to master specific lifecycle phases or capability streams, enabling them to align IT services directly with organizational strategy in Germany.

Core Competences of Intermediate Professionals

  • Designing and implementing robust service transition strategies
  • Operating and optimizing daily IT infrastructure services
  • Leading continual service improvement initiatives across business units
  • Managing service offerings, agreements, and customer portfolios

Strategic Value for German Enterprise Projects

Organizations in Germany rely on these certified experts to bridge the gap between business goals and IT operations. Their structured approach to service management ensures compliance with local and international standards, reduces operational downtime, and streamlines service desks during complex digital transformations.

Transitioning from Legacy v3 to ITIL 4

While originating in the v3 framework, practitioners holding these credentials possess the structural knowledge easily adaptable to modern ITIL 4 Specialist modules. They understand the core principles of value streams and service relationship management, making them highly versatile assets for legacy maintenance and modern migrations.

The ITIL Intermediate credential validates an IT professional's deep knowledge of service management processes, divided into Service Lifecycle and Service Capability streams. It proves their ability to analyze, implement, and improve IT services according to industry best practices.

While the Foundation level introduces basic terminology and concepts, the ITIL Intermediate qualification requires candidates to demonstrate practical application and analysis of these concepts. It prepares professionals to lead service management teams and manage complex operational phases.

Yes, professionals who completed the ITIL Intermediate modules under v3 hold highly respected knowledge of structured service processes. Many have transitioned their credits toward the newer ITIL 4 Managing Professional designation, ensuring their expertise remains aligned with modern agile and DevOps environments.

They are critical during major IT service migrations, service desk restructuring, and IT service management tool implementations. Companies in Germany frequently engage ITIL Intermediate experts to establish standardized service level agreements and audit operational efficiency.

Candidates must hold the ITIL Foundation certificate before attempting any intermediate modules. Additionally, completing an accredited training course from an authorized provider like PeopleCert is mandatory before sitting for the exams.

Most projects in Germany require ITIL Intermediate freelancers to be fluent in German for stakeholder coordination, while technical documentation is often handled in English. This dual-language capability is essential for aligning local IT operations with global corporate standards.

The Lifecycle stream focuses on management and coordination across broad phases like Service Strategy and Service Design, whereas the Capability stream provides deep technical knowledge on specific activities like Release, Control, and Validation. Freelancers holding ITIL Intermediate credentials have typically specialized in one of these pathways to suit their career focus.

The legacy v3 ITIL Intermediate certificates do not have a formal expiration date, but modern equivalents under the PeopleCert Continuing Professional Development program encourage regular renewal. Professionals maintain their active status by submitting professional development points or taking bridging exams to current ITIL standards.
